Other criminal offenses in Soria

Detailed analysis of this type of crime across Spanish territory

Crimes of type "Other criminal offenses" in the province of Soria totaled 40 recorded cases in 2024. This figure represents a variation of -4.8% compared to the previous year.

In the province of Soria, located in the Castilla y León region of Spain, the category of "Other criminal offenses" has shown a notable decline in recent years. The recorded cases decreased from 48 in 2022 to 40 in 2024, reflecting a year-over-year change of -4.8%.
